Community rallies to preserve Bridal Veil Falls for future generations
During a recent government meeting, community members expressed strong support for the preservation and enhancement of Bridal Veil Falls, a popular natural site in Utah County. One passionate speaker highlighted the potential for the site to become a major attraction, similar to Oregon's Multnomah Falls, emphasizing the importance of creating a safe and beautiful environment for future generations.

The discussion included concerns about overdevelopment and the need for maintenance to ensure the site remains accessible and enjoyable for all visitors. Craig Christiansen, representing Conserve Utah Valley, underscored the significance of keeping the area free and natural, reflecting the overwhelming feedback from public sessions advocating for minimal development.

The collaborative efforts of local legislators and county commissioners were praised, with participants expressing gratitude for their commitment to preserving the site. The meeting concluded with a call for action from the committee, signaling a collective desire to protect Bridal Veil Falls for generations to come.
